Which is why 2080's night at The War Room is the best place to blow off all your midweek steam: DJs Fourcolorzack and Scene don't just play '80s jams, they break out the '80s jams you forgot about, would never hear on the radio (unless it's KEXP), or never even heard in the first place. These guys are experts at sifting through, selecting, and remixing should-be classics to keep the party hopping. And it is hopping, even though it's on a Wednesday, when most people would rather stay home.
